Darien police swore in their new chief of police with a ceremony on Friday.
The police commission appointment Jeremiah P. Marron Jr. as the department’s 12th chief of police.
"To the Darien community, I promise an accountable, professional and accessible police department that is responsive to your concerns, transparency will continue to be the corner stone of our approach," said Marron.
Chief Marron assumed command of the department as chief of police on April 1, following the retirement of the current chief, Donald B. Anderson.
Chief Marron has been in the Darien Police Department for 28 years.
